I need help.
I just finish assembling my xi sport last week
And i went to the track today for practice. And my xi sport is so slow on the straigh line. My xi sport is all stock. Can someone tell me what pinion gear i should use. Right now i have 25t 48p & spur is 85t. Motor trackstar 21.5t & esc hobbyking.
Thanks
Aris

your fdr with 85 spur and 25 pinion is around 7.1. You want to be around 4. ie: smaller spur and bigger pinion, 69 and 36
